Voglio costruire un Fitness Tracker, come devo procedere?
Dal punto di vista di uno sviluppatore, i passi per costruire un'app di fitness non sono molto diversi da qualsiasi altra, ad esempio, un'app per l'assistenza sanitaria o un messenger. Lo sviluppo di tutte le app mobili inizia con la concettualizzazione e termina con il deployment e la manutenzione.
Il processo di sviluppo dell'app comprende diverse fasi che possono essere chiamate con termini diversi ed essere eseguite simultaneamente o di conseguenza:
- Possiamo considerare la fase di scoperta come un intenso brainstorming prima del processo di sviluppo vero e proprio. Definisce il futuro prodotto attraverso le sue specifiche, l'architettura e il design, e permette la stima dei costi del progetto.
- La fase di sviluppo del prodotto segue e procede secondo il piano approvato, i requisiti del cliente e le revisioni incrementali. Per gli sviluppatori, un vero tesoro avere un piano passo dopo passo a cui attenersi.
- Durante la fase di revisione, i membri del team trovano errori o difetti e li correggono in modo che il prodotto soddisfi i requisiti definiti durante la fase di scoperta.
- La fase di deployment consiste nel consegnare il prodotto agli utenti. Prima di rilasciarlo sul mercato vero e proprio, possono anche spostare il prodotto attraverso più ambienti di test o di distribuzione di staging.
- La fase di manutenzione è un processo costante che garantisce la coerenza della qualità e dell'affidabilità del prodotto.
Articoli simili
- I gadget come fitness tracker/activity tracker sono davvero utili?
- Come devo procedere dopo aver aggiornato il mio municipio al livello 7?
- Cosa devo fare se voglio provare una prova gratuita ma non voglio dare i dati della mia vera carta di credito?
- Software di assistenza al poker: Dovrei usare poker tracker, hold'em manager o poker edge? (Vale la pena usare poker tracker?)